Output 2e3768bb17bd3fa2491b88b2396675730ae98b577570840995b137489976ece8:22

value
66782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d64982b3ce95073ac18be0766a94e02dfc7d96 OP_EQUAL
address
343dXGiT8uoLAunCa8TnWfpv84m6LN2ur7
transaction
2e3768bb17bd3fa2491b88b2396675730ae98b577570840995b137489976ece8
confirmations
176348
spent
true